The Center for International Forestry Research (CIFOR) and World Agroforestry (ICRAF) envision a more equitable world where trees in all landscapes, from drylands to the humid tropics, enhance the environment and well-being for all. CIFOR and ICRAF are non-profit science institutions that build and apply evidence to today’s most pressing challenges, including energy insecurity and the climate and biodiversity crises. Over a combined total of 65 years, we have built vast knowledge on forests and trees outside of forests in agricultural landscapes (agroforestry). Using a multidisciplinary approach, we seek to improve lives and to protect and restore ecosystems. Our work focuses on innovative research, partnering for impact, and engaging with stakeholders on policies and practices to benefit people and the planet. Founded in 1993 and 1978, CIFOR and ICRAF are members of CGIAR, a global research partnership for a food secure future dedicated to reducing poverty, enhancing food and nutrition security, and improving natural resources.
Under the supervision of the head of SPACIAL the Spatial Data Scientist – Remote Sensing will lead and implement advanced remote sensing analysis tasks, including processing of optical and SAR data, timeseries analysis, and predictive modeling with primary focus on the modeling of temporal dynamics across complex landscapes. The position will support a range of projects and programmes across CIFOR-ICRAF, including Regreening Africa, Knowledge for Great Green Wall Action (K4GGWA). Towards Ending Drought Emergencies (Twende), and upcoming assessments of soil and land health with funding from NORAD.
• PhD or MSc degree in spatial data science, geoinformatics, computer science, or a related
quantitative field with demonstrated expertise in machine learning and AI applications.
• Proven experience developing and deploying machine learning models for geospatial applications.
• Strong proficiency in deep learning frameworks (TensorFlow, PyTorch, Keras) and familiarity with
architectures such as CNNs, RNNs, LSTMs, and Transformers.
• Advanced programming skills in Python and/or R Statistics; familiarity with Julia is a plus.
• Experience with cloud computing platforms (GEE, AWS, GCP) and big data processing tools for
geospatial analysis.
• Knowledge of remote sensing data processing and analysis, including optical and SAR platforms
• This is a Globally Recruited Staff (GRS) position. CIFOR-ICRAF offers competitive remuneration in USD, commensurate with skills and experience.
• The appointment will be for two (2) year period, inclusive of a six-month probationary period, with the possibility of extension contingent upon performance, continued relevance of the position and available resources.
• The duty station will be in Kenya, Nairobi or Remote.
